1. A process for preparing an affinity chromatographic matrix comprising the steps of:

  • reacting a polymeric substance containing at least one hydroxyl group with 2-fluoro-1-methylpyridinium toluene-4-sulfonate to form an activated polymer wherein at least some of the hydroxyl groups of said polymer have been converted to 1-methyl-2-pyridoxy groups; and

    reacting said 1-methyl-2-pyridoxy substituted polymer with polyethyleneimine to form an affinity chromatographic matrix in which at least some of the 1-methyl-2-pyridoxy groups have been replaced by said polyethyleneimine.
